The technology is not advanced enough yet to be that much more enjoyable. Short films are available which are promotional videos for the vr tech. If you鈥檙e planning to pick up a headset,go for the one with the best resolution. Those slide your mobile phone into it kinds are worthless. I personally get nauseous after about 15-20 minutes
